In the first chapter, I read a section titled, “The Critical Essay”. This paragraph states that the writer presumes that the reader has seen or is at least familiar with the film under discussion. This kind of essay would be similar to a critical review of a piece of work. It is a review of a movie. A critical essay is different than just a review because the critical essay is much more specific. People like to read critical essays because they have the ability to enlighten people of new materials or topics within the film, even if they have seen the movie already. The critical essay is a more in depth review.
